Storage of nuclear waste poses threat to US, scientists warn
Published Sun, May 28, 2017 · 09:50 PM
Washington
THE reluctance of US federal regulators to require operators of nuclear reactors to spend US$5 billion to enhance the security of spent fuel rods stored underground threatens the country with a potential catastrophe, scientists warned on Friday.
The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) greatly underestimated the risk and potential contamination of a nuclear waste fire triggered by a quake or a planned attack, experts writing in the journal Science said.
